Let's look at the Proverb. It's an interesting flip side of something we've already talked about in my blogs on Proverbs. We already talked about how it's wise to keep silent sometimes. But today we're going to look at righteous speech, which will continue forever, and wicked speech, whose days are numbered.
Verse 31 says, "From the mouth of the righteous comes the fruit of wisdom, but a perverse tongue will be silenced." We're hearing alot of perverse tongues today, aren't we? Hollywood is replete with them. Politicians lie so often that it's impossible to understand what anyone in power really means. But one day they will be silenced, and the lies will cease.
But the righteous will continue speaking for eternity, and the fruit of wisdom will come from their lips. We can look forward to hearing only truth and beauty forever.
